Testimonials from Users of Free Software
by John Sullivan published Mar 25, 2005 last modified Sep 18, 2009 04:40 PM
For those working to persuade others to use free software, it is very helpful to have stories from people in similar situations who successfully converted from proprietary software. We collect such stories from our community to meet that need. We will also be collecting links to formal articles and papers that show the benefits of free software.
